Subject: Potential Acquisition — Velmora Systems

Team,

We have entered preliminary discussions with Velmora Systems regarding a possible acquisition of their Harlow-based analytics unit. Due diligence begins next week, led by Priya and the corporate development group. Department heads should prepare summaries of integration impacts for their areas by Friday. No external communication is authorized at this stage, and all related materials must stay within this distribution list. Please treat the following note as strictly confidential.

board note of baweg-bawig: Project Tamath slips by six weeks because of the audit delay.

## Health Checks — Marrowgate Edge

The Marrowgate load balancer probes each backend on a dedicated health endpoint, separate from application routes. A backend is drained after three consecutive failures and re-added after two successes. Probes bypass authentication, so the endpoint must never expose data. If an instance flaps, check disk pressure first — it's the usual cause. The balancer applies the following health-check configuration values.

config for yahag-tagag:
oliael:
  log_level: info
  metrics_host: metrics.oliael.tolvaqsys.internal
  pin: 4558
  pool_size: 8

Finance Review Summary — Hedging Decision

Reviewed Q3 exposure on the Velran crown following the Osterfeld expansion. Forward contracts locked for 70% of projected receivables; remainder floats per Tavrin's model. Cost of carry acceptable; downside capped at tolerance threshold. No objections from treasury. Decision stands through year-end unless volatility doubles. The strategic rationale behind the partial hedge is noted below.

confidential, bahop-hahif: Only 3 of the 140 pilot accounts renewed Oliath, so a churn review is set for July 15.

## Approvals: Websocket Reconnect Fix

This page tracks sign-off for the patch addressing the reconnect storm in the Pondbridge gateway, where dropped websocket sessions retried without backoff and overwhelmed the edge nodes. The fix adds jittered exponential backoff and caps concurrent reconnect attempts per client. QA has verified behavior under simulated network flaps, and load testing passed on staging. Before we schedule the rollout, we need one final approval per our change policy. The approver responsible for this change is named below.

account owner for tawip-kahop: Oliok Jorix Ulaath Quenok